Molecular diversity analysis of Asparagus racemosus and its adulterants using random amplified polymorphic DNA (RAPD)

Leaves of 28 genotypes of 4 species of the genusAsparagus,namely:Asparagus racemosus,Asparagus falcatus,Asparagus officinalisandAsparagus plumosuswere analyzed for genetic diversity by random amplified polymorphic DNA (RAPD). Out of one hundred 10-mer RAPD primers screened, 25 were selected for comparative analysis of different accessions ofA. racemosusand its closely related species. High genetic variations were found between the differentAsparagusspecies studied. Among a total of 296 RAPD fragments amplified, 287 bands (96.95%) were found polymorphic in the four species.Averagepolymorphic information content (PIC) value for the amplification product was 0.23.Fourteen species-specific bands were found inA. racemosusspecies.These species-specific RAPD markers could potentially be used for identifying authenticA. racemosusspp.andcould be sequenced for conversion to a sequence-characterized amplified region (SCAR) markerso as to serve as species specific marker.Jaccard’s genetic similarity co-efficient varied from0.19 to 0.85.Theunweighted pair group method with arithmetic average (UPGMA) dendrogram was constructed on the basis of Jaccard’s genetic similarity co-efficient valuesthat separate the three other species ofAsparagusfromA. racemosusaccessions.Results of this study will facilitateauthenticA. racemosusidentification, thereby aiding drug standardization, its collection, management and conservation.
